CFPB opens 30-day public comment period on its big-tech data inquiry; input due Dec. 6

November 5, 2021 0

The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au’s (CFPB) inquiry into the business practices of six large technology firms operating payments systems in the United States will be open for public comment until Dec. 6, according to a […]

Letter reminds credit unions that secondary capital issuances after Jan. 1 subject to new subordinated rule

November 5, 2021 0

Any issuances of secondary capital not completed by Jan. 1 will be subject to the requirements of the new subordinated debt rule, which becomes effective on that date, according to a letter sent Friday by […]
